Seared Salmon with Roasted Asparagus and Sweet Potato Mash
Enjoy a beautifully balanced dinner featuring a perfectly seared salmon paired with tender roasted asparagus and a velvety sweet potato mash. This dish brings together savory and naturally sweet flavors, accented with a hint of olive oil for a light, fresh finish.
INGREDIENTS
6 oz Salmon Fillet
1 small Sweet Potato
6 spears Asparagus
1/4 tbsp Olive Oil
Pinch Salt
Pinch Black Pepper
PREPARATION
Preheat your oven to 400°F.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
Peel and cube the sweet potato. Boil or steam until tender, then mash lightly with a fork. Season with a pinch of salt and pepper.
Trim the woody ends of the asparagus. Toss the asparagus with a small drizzle of olive oil, salt, and pepper, and spread out on the baking sheet.
Roast the asparagus in the oven for 10-12 minutes until tender and slightly caramelized.
Meanwhile, pat the salmon dry and season both sides with salt and pepper.
Heat a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at. Add 1/4 tablespoon olive oil and sear the salmon skin-side down for about 3-4 minutes until crispy, then gently flip and cook for an additional 3-4 minutes until the salmon is just opaque in the center.
Plate the seared salmon alongside a serving of sweet potato mash and roasted asparagus. Serve warm and enjoy!
